Summary
After you create a client-side geocoding service, you may want to share it with other users. You might do this by copying the geocoding service and associated geocoding indexes and reference data to a shared network folder or a CD.
Procedure
The following steps illustrate the process for sharing your geocoding services.
- Create the geocoding service.
- Copy the geocoding service and associated reference data to the location where other users will be able to access it.
- Right-click the geocoding service in ArcCatalog and click Properties.
- Click the Browse button and navigate to the new location of the reference data.
- Check the 'Use relative path names' option.
- Click OK to save the geocoding service.
